What Does a Sleep Therapist Do?


A sleep therapist specializes in identifying and treating rest problems. These professionals are often learnt cognitive-behavioral methods and various other healing methods to boost sleep patterns and overall wellness. They resolve both the behavioral and emotional elements of rest conditions, making their method alternative and comprehensive.


Trick duties of a sleep specialist include:



  • Conducting assessments to detect sleep problems.

  • Producing customized therapy plans for concerns such as sleep wake problem.

  • Using cognitive-behavioral treatment for sleeplessness (CBT-I).

  • Addressing way of living elements that add to poor rest.

  • Coordinating treatment with various other experts like rest disorder physicians or general practitioners.


Typical Sleep Disorders Treated by a Sleep Therapist


A rest therapist is furnished to take care of a vast array of sleep-related issues. Let's take a better look at a few of one of the most usual disorders they can assist with:


1. Sleep Wake Disorder


This problem entails a mismatch between your body's body clock and the external environment, commonly bring about difficulties in maintaining a routine sleep routine. A sleep therapist can assist you straighten your body clock with light treatment, behavior modifications, and leisure methods.


2. Narcolepsy Treatment


Narcolepsy is a neurological problem that triggers extreme daytime drowsiness and unexpected muscle mass weakness (cataplexy). A sleep therapist jobs carefully with a sleep medicine physician to create a management plan, which might consist of behavioral techniques and medication adjustments.


3. Parasomnia Treatment


Parasomnias are turbulent rest habits, such as sleepwalking, headaches, or sleep talking. While these actions can be distressing, they are treatable. A rest therapist frequently employs strategies to determine triggers and decrease episodes, particularly with sleep talking treatment or various other targeted therapies.


4. Hypersomnia Treatment


Hypersomnia entails excessive drowsiness throughout the day, also after a full evening's remainder. A sleep specialist assesses potential underlying causes, such as way of living variables, medical problems, or mental tension, and creates methods to manage extreme sleepiness.


5. Sleep problems


One of one of the most common sleep problems, insomnia is defined by trouble dropping or staying asleep. CBT-I, supplied by an sleeping disorders physician or rest therapist, is among the most effective treatments available.


Exactly How Sleep Therapists Approach Treatment


The job of a sleep specialist includes numerous evidence-based strategies customized to the special demands of each individual. Below are a few of the most usual techniques used in sleep treatment:


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y for Insomnia (CBT-I)


CBT-I is a keystone of sleep treatment. It concentrates on recognizing and transforming thought patterns and behaviors that hinder sleep. As an example, you could:



  • Develop a regular going to bed routine.

  • Discover leisure strategies to handle pre-sleep stress and anxiety.

  • Reframe unfavorable ideas concerning sleep.


Lifestyle and Behavioral Modifications


A sleep therapist might recommend changes to your day-to-day routines, such as:



  • Avoiding high levels of caffeine or heavy meals before bed.

  • Establishing a relaxing going to bed regimen.

  • Limiting screen time in the evening.


Education and learning and Support


Many individuals gain from understanding their condition. A rest therapist provides resources and support to equip you to handle your sleep concerns efficiently. This is especially practical for problems like sleep wake disorder or narcolepsy, where ongoing education and learning can boost results.


Partnership with Other Specialists


Sometimes, a sleep therapist works alongside various other specialists, such as sleep problem physicians or an insomnia doctor, to ensure a comprehensive strategy to therapy. For instance, a rest medicine doctor may offer medicines while the therapist focuses on behavior modifications.


When Should You See a Sleep Therapist?


If you experience any of the following, it may be time to get in touch with a sleep therapist:



  • Chronic problem dropping or staying asleep.

  • Extreme daytime drowsiness, also after adequate rest.

  • Unusual actions during sleep, such as sleepwalking or sleep speaking.

  • Signs and symptoms of disorders like hypersomnia, narcolepsy, or parasomnia.

  • Persistent feelings of tiredness or absence of power.

Self-Help Tips to Complement Sleep Therapy


While working with a rest specialist, you can embrace these self-help strategies to boost your rest health:



  • Stick to a Sleep Schedule: Go to bed and wake up at the same time every day, also on weekends.

  • Create a Sleep-Friendly Environment: Keep your room cool, dark, and peaceful.

  • Practice Relaxation Techniques: Deep breathing, reflection, or progressive muscle leisure can help you take a break prior to bed.

  • Monitor Your Sleep Habits: Keep a journal to track your rest patterns and identify triggers.

  • Restriction Stimulants: Avoid high levels of caffeine and nicotine in the hours leading up to going to bed.
